Overview

The Kosovo temporary residence page lists a work-purpose category. Work applicants provide a travel document valid at least three months beyond the requested residence period, an employment contract under Kosovo labour law unless the applicant owns the business, sufficient means, a no-investigation certificate, business registration and business information, education or qualification evidence unless exempt as a business owner, health insurance and no entry ban.

Eligibility

Typical criteria

  • ✓The applicant has a Kosovo work purpose supported by an employment contract, unless the applicant is the business owner.Ministry of Internal Affairs, Republic of Kosovo ↗
  • ✓The travel document is valid at least three months longer than the requested residence period.Ministry of Internal Affairs, Republic of Kosovo ↗
  • ✓The file includes sufficient means, business registration and business information.Ministry of Internal Affairs, Republic of Kosovo ↗
  • ✓The applicant has health insurance, no entry ban and no-investigation evidence from the relevant foreign state or last residence state.Ministry of Internal Affairs, Republic of Kosovo ↗

Common blockers

  • !No employment contract, employer basis or qualifying business-owner exception.Ministry of Internal Affairs, Republic of Kosovo ↗
  • !Business registration, business information or qualification evidence is missing where required.Ministry of Internal Affairs, Republic of Kosovo ↗
  • !The applicant has an entry ban, incomplete health insurance or missing no-investigation evidence.Ministry of Internal Affairs, Republic of Kosovo ↗

Typical evidence

  • ·Valid travel document with at least three months beyond the requested permit period.Ministry of Internal Affairs, Republic of Kosovo ↗
  • ·Employment contract under Kosovo labour law, unless the applicant is the business owner.Ministry of Internal Affairs, Republic of Kosovo ↗
  • ·Bank statement or employment contract showing sufficient means.Ministry of Internal Affairs, Republic of Kosovo ↗
  • ·No-investigation certificate, business registration and information, education or qualification evidence, health insurance and vaccination evidence where an epidemic condition applies.Ministry of Internal Affairs, Republic of Kosovo ↗

Application pathway

  1. 01

    Check the route fit

    Confirm whether the case is employee, NGO employee or business-owner work residence.

  2. 02

    Build the evidence pack

    Collect travel, employment, business, qualification, financial and insurance evidence.

  3. 03

    Submit through the official channel

    Translate foreign no-investigation and qualification documents into an official Kosovo language where required.

  4. 04

    After approval

    Submit the temporary residence file and calendar renewal within 30 days before expiry.

Frequently asked questions

Is an employment contract always required?+−

The Interior Ministry page lists an employment contract for work residence, but says the contract is not required for a foreigner who is the business owner.

What fee is listed for work-purpose temporary residence?+−

The official page lists 50 euros for temporary residence for work.
